[QUOTE="Timr, post: 907295, member: 16236"] That's not likely. Check out this quote from DC's Racerhead on racerxill.com: The GPs, by the way, were won by Stefan Everts and Tyla Rattray, the two odds-on favorites to win. And the Youthstream people went ahead with their plan to pay no purse money. In other words, I will make as much in prize money today at Castillo Ranch as Everts did for winning his record-extending 80th Grand Prix. No wonder everyone wants to come to America and race. By the way, Giuseppe Luongo’s decision to stop paying prize money altogether does not bode well for Team USA, Chad Reed, Grant Langston or anyone else racing on this continent to go to the 2005 Motocross des Nations…. Well, yeah, Team Canada will go, but that’s only because hockey will probably still be on strike. [/QUOTE]
